My husband told me twice during dinner to put this in the regular rotation as he calls it! I substituted a couple things like 2 sweet sausage links and 2 hot, fennel bulb instead of celery and long grain white rice instead of brown and wild oh! and I seem to have forgotten the thyme, but it was yummy. I will say though that it is good to drain the sausage after it browns since it spews out oil. Oh this too, with white rice it doesn't need as much broth, just 3 cups and about 20-25 minutes.
